Aahh – the clink of fine stemware, mod lamps that cast sultry lighting, cocktails with more ingredients than your last shopping list… you don’t have to drive to the city to find the finer things in life – just step outside your door. When you’re looking to hobnob Tahoe-style, dress to impress, grab your wallet and head to one of our top 10 posh bars around the lake:

On the South Side

Opal Ultra Lounge, Inside MontBleu Casino, 55 Highway 50, South Lake Tahoe, Nev.
Hours: Fri – Sun, 8 p.m. to close

You’ll forget you’re in a small town when you walk into Opal’s feel of big-city sophistication. Dark wood lines a long bar and dramatically draped semi-private booths offer table service where cocktail servers roll liquor carts by to mix your beverage. Friday and Saturday nights bring DJ’s spinning groove lounge music and Sunday evening features disco remixes. Feeling exotic but can’t afford a trip to Istanbul? For $20 (and $10 on Sunday), you can rent a hookah for your table; smoke flavored tobaccos in this Turkish water pipe and whisk yourself to another land.

Most luscious libation: Sample one of the vintage cocktails – when was the last time you had a killer Rob Roy or Sidecar?

Cliché, inside Harrah’s Casino,15 Hwy 50, Stateline, Nev.
Hours: Thurs & Fri: 6 - 9 p.m., Sat: 5:30 - 10 p.m.

Lounging at Cliché is like taking a nightcap in Uncle Alastair’s Manhattan parlor - sophisticated furniture and regal touches grace this highbrow room on the casino’s 16th floor. Walls are lined with wood and glass cases that display a selection of fine cognacs, wines and ports. One wall’s case is a humidor stocked with an impressive cigar selection, and Cliché boasts a unique air ventilation system that whisk offending cigar fumes out of the room.

Most luscious libation: Ask a server to recommend a unique cigar and cocktail pairing.

19 Kitchen-Bar, Inside Harveys Casino, Highway 50 at Stateline Ave., South Lake Tahoe, Nev.
Hours: 19’s Bar is open 7 days serving a limited menu on Sun and Mon night

Plush couches are tucked into a bank of bay windows lining a whole wall of this 19th story lounge. Watch the lake and the town lights sparkle as you sample from 19’s huge liquor selection or from their list of 19 specialty martinis. Once the sun sets, small flat screen TV’s in each table nook can provide sporting entertainment.

Most luscious libation: The Mafia Kiss Martini – we’d tell you more about it, but then we’d have to kill you.

Chart House, 392 Kingsbury Grade, South Lake Tahoe, Nev.
Hours: Sun – Fri, 5:30 p.m. to Close, Sat, 5 to 10:30 p.m.

Searching for candlelit romance and bewitching views? Tucked up on Kingsbury Grade, Chart House offers an elegant country club feel and beautiful Tahoe panoramas. Their lounge boasts a pages-long menu of liquors, wines, specialty drinks and light fare.

Most luscious libation: Try a Mango or Blueberry Mojito with fresh fruits and mint.



On the North Side

PlumpJack Café, 1920 Squaw Valley Road, Olympic Valley, Calif.
Hours: Lunch & Bar Menu, 11:30 a.m. -10 p.m. daily

For a true après ski experience, take a nip in PlumpJack Café. Their lovely lounge is decorated with funky-chic furniture and features a menu of creative cocktails like the Absinthe Drip Martini and Maple Julep. PlumpJack also hosts monthly wine classes and outdoor patio dining in the summer.

Most luscious libation: Try the intriguingly refreshing Springtini – it’s made with elderflower liquor and 3 secret ingredients.

Sol y Lago, inside the Boatworks Mall, 760 N. Lake Blvd., Tahoe City, Calif.
Hours: Tapas menu daily from 4:20 p.m. – close

Worldly and urbane combine in Sol y Lago’s unique mix of Latin American flavor and city sophistication. Stunning lake views compliment a large selection of Latin American wines, exotic drinks, sangria and a lengthy margarita list. Visit one of Sol y Lago’s DJ parties to add some classy music spin to your evening.

Most luscious libation: Forget that prosaic Red Bull and Vodka, try a Cola De Mono (monkey’s tail) instead: Stoli Vanil vodka, Kahlua liqueur infused with fresh espresso, hand shaken and garnished with espresso beans. Zowie!

Moody’s Bistro, 10007 Bridge Street, Truckee, Calif.
Hours: 2:30-9:30 p.m. Sun-Thurs, 2:30-10 p.m. Fri & Sat. Music on Wed – Sat evenings

(check website calendar for performance start times)
Nothing feels as cosmopolitan as a dark, sultry jazz bar. Get your saxophone fix at Moody’s, where you’re surrounded by red walls, candlelight and fellow music lovers. Moody’s dedication to unique and fresh foods is apparent in their beverage selection and menus and they welcome an eclectic selection of musicians playing free shows weekly. Especially popular among the 20-30 something crowd is DJ OneTruest who spins reggae and dance hall beats every Wednesday night starting at 9 p.m.

Most luscious libation: Kick summer into gear with a Kiwi Lemon Martini: Skyy Citrus Vodka, freshly squeezed Meyer lemon, a splash of simple syrup and muddled fresh Kiwi.

Bite, 907 Tahoe Blvd., Incline Village, Nev.
Hours: 4:30 to midnight Wed - Mon, closed Tuesdays

Incline Village welcomes this new and stylish entry into its entertainment scene. Bite is decorated with simple sophistication and features DJ evenings and a wide selection of American Tapas (try the mini Beef Wellingtons). Their wine list hits enough pricepoints to satisfy everyone, and they boast an innovative menu of modern cocktails based on vintage recipes. Gentlemen take note – on a recent early Saturday evening visit, the ratio of women to men in Bite’s bar was about 10 to 1… difficult odds to beat in Tahoe!

Most luscious libation: The cool Lime-Basil Gimlet is a warm evening must.

Lone Eagle, Hyatt Regency Lake Tahoe, 111 Country Club Drive, Incline Village, Nev.
Hours: Mon - Thurs: 11 a.m. to 10 p.m., Fri - Sat: 11 a.m. to 11 p.m., Sun: 5 to 11 p.m.

A North Shore standby, the lounge at the Lone Eagle is always an elegant respite from the rigors of mountain life. Cozy fires in the winter, congenial outdoor fire pits in the summer and year-round lake views through floor to cathedral ceiling windows make the Lone Eagle a continually popular spot. Rub elbows with Incline’s real estate elite at the bar or meet one of the many tourists conferencing at the Hyatt. The Lone Eagle offers a nice lounge menu of wines, cocktails and appetizers and features live music.

Most luscious libation: In the summer months, take a stroll down the pier and order a Pomegranate Lemonade from the pier bar.

Big Water Grille, 341 Ski Way, Incline Village, Nev.
Hours: Bar opens at 4:30 p.m., 7 days/week

The bar at Big Water Grille is another all-season spot for a tasteful happy hour experience. Sit on the deck in the summer for hillside lake views, or around the fireplace when the snow falls. Big Water offers a wide liquor and wine selection and a tempting seasonal bar menu. This spot shakes up some of the best martinis on the lake, so sip away as you watch the sun go down.

Most luscious libation: Order the Roasted Medjool Date & Goat Cheese Tart appetizer off of the dinner menu and ask for a wine pairing. Heaven!
